GC Notes:

The puzzle can be summed up as this: teams are pantomimed actions to perform, and must perform them in the correct order. Staffers will need to watch for the team performing each action, and unlock content for them via a website for each correct action.

In more detail; the puzzle has 4 ghost characters (simplified as A, B, C, and D) that are projected inside of a tent and silently act out a series of actions. Each of these actions can be performed with something lying around the campground (e.g., the first action of the first ghost is flipping a frying pan, indicating that someone must pick up the pan by the fake fire and pretend to cook with it).

There is a website proctors will be able to access that will show a button indicating what the next action is supposed to be. If a player does the right action, click the button for it and their book should beep, giving them a new page that acknowledges they got it right and gives them data for the puzzle.

Upon completing each ghost's "story," a new ghost shows up in the projector with a new set of actions. These must occur in parallel with all previous ghosts, building on the previous story until all 4 ghosts have been unlocked.

The puzzle in the book reveals 4 hidden actions that must be performed. When all 4 ghosts are unlocked, if a team performs all 4 actions then they are given an ending page with the answer. If any of the actions failed to occur, they are given a bad ending and the last chapter should be reset. None of these special actions have a corresponding real-world object, so teams only have to act it out and can pretend to do it however the proctor sees fit (e.g., one action is setting an alarm, if they simply yell "I am setting an alarm," that is fine).

Some more important notes:

  • Some actions need to be performed in parallel. For example, when the second ghost is unlocked, one camper should be cooking over the fire while the second plays cards at the table. There is a keep going button for this scenario to give the teams a chance to realize they both have to do something.

Presentation:

Teams will walk in a large room and find a fake/abandoned camp ground with various camp items strewn about (fishing pole, marshmallows on a stick, etc) and a large tent that they are instructed not to touch. One item is a book, when teams pick this up, a projection of a ghost appears to pantomime several actions.

Staff Notes for Intro Email

You're receiving this mail because you are currently staffing Ghost Stories at the hub. I plan on doing walkthroughs of the puzzle in person, but thought it would be helpful to run through what staffing the puzzle will be like. Apologies for getting this out so late.

For those who haven't seen the puzzle before, we will have rooms set up as a fake campsite. There will be a tent, a table, and various areas marked off with blue tape to represent other things (e.g., a lake, beds). On the table will be an Amazon Fire tablet on a special webpage. Inside the tent is a projector, where a 'ghost' will give teams instructions on what to do.

Your role as staff is to watch the teams perform these actions and either acknowledge/accept that they did the right action in the right order, or to hit a fail button that causes them to reset to the current 'story' they're on. Here is a screenshot of the staffing webpage on the left and what teams will see in the book on the right:

In this example, the players just performed the "cooking" action, and the next one they need to perform is "Eating." The actions they perform are mostly linear and all involve interacting with set pieces, with one notable exception I will explain in detail later in this mail. If one of the players sits at the table and pretends to eat, you should click the "A: Eating" button, and a new page will appear for them as well as a new action for you to watch for.

Part of the puzzle is bolded text in the storybook instructing the players to perform 'secret' actions that do not have set pieces. In the example above, "Make" is the first word in a sentence "make sure fire extinguished," instructing teams that one of their members should make sure to put the fire out before going to bed. This can happen at almost any time, though proctors should use discretion when unlocking it (i.e., they shouldn't put out the fire early on, as one action is roasting marshmallows).

As teams finish each story, a new ghost appears with new actions that must be performed with the previous ghost's actions (i.e., when ghost B is unlocked, teams now need two players performing actions in order and sometimes at the same time). This continues until there are 4 ghost characters, at which point the administration software should track whether they have completed special actions and given them either a "good" ending (with the puzzle answer), or a "bad" ending, where upon hearing that they've read it you should click the "Fail" button to reset them to the beginning of the 4th story.

I recommend you bring a laptop for this; the administration page does work with phones, but it could be easier to have it and the book up on the same screen (as with the screenshot above), just so you have a sense of what teams are seeing.

Below is a table with the list of actions each ghost performs. Each row is a ghost, and the columns represent a time slice (i.e., an item on the left should happen before an item to the right of it, items in the same column should happen simultaneously. So below, when B is unlocked, camper B should fish first, then actor A cooks while actor B plays cards)
